    Where were you 10 years ago? Reanimation divided the fanbase. So did Meteora. MtM even more so. ATS even more than that. ATS didn't sell as well for a few reasons. #1: Warner pays for marketing. They didn't put as much money into ATS as other albums. #2. Linkin Park are still classified as "rock", and ATS is not a rock album. #3. It's not "Pop", which is why Warner didn't put money into it in the first place.....and all opinions aside, people aren't going to remember LP for any album but Hybrid Theory. They will remember "Numb", "What I've Done", possibly "Shadow of the Day" and "Waiting for the End".
